Foundation Repair Costs - Repairing masonry foundations typically ranges from $2,000 to $10,000, depending on the extent of damage. For example, minor crack repairs may cost around $2,500, while major structural fixes can reach $8,000 or more.
Brick and Masonry Wall Restoration - Restoring or replacing damaged bricks and mortar generally costs between $1,500 and $6,000. Smaller projects, like patching cracks, might be around $1,500, whereas complete wall rebuilds can exceed $5,000.
Chimney Repair Expenses - Masonry chimney repairs typically fall within the $1,000 to $4,000 range. Minor tuckpointing or crack sealing may be closer to $1,200, while extensive rebuilds or liner replacements can reach $4,000 or more.
Surface Restoration and Sealing - Masonry surface sealing or restoration services usually cost between $500 and $2,500. Basic sealing for small areas might be around $500, with larger or more detailed work increasing the cost accordingly.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of masonry repair services are available? Local masonry contractors offer services such as crack repair, repointing, stone replacement, and structural reinforcement to address various issues with masonry structures.
How can I tell if my masonry needs repair? Signs like cracks, bulges, crumbling mortar, or water infiltration may indicate the need for professional masonry assessment and repair services.
What causes damage to masonry structures? Common causes include weathering, settling, freeze-thaw cycles, and improper construction or maintenance, which can lead to deterioration over time.
What is the typical process for masonry repair? Masonry repair generally involves assessment, cleaning, preparation, and applying appropriate repair techniques such as repointing, patching, or reinforcement by local specialists.
How long does masonry repair usually take? The duration depends on the extent of damage and the scope of work, with minor repairs often completed within a day and more extensive projects taking longer.
